深度解析:DeepSeek赋能量化交易策略组合优化与收益稳定性提升
2025.09.26 17:18浏览量:8简介:本文详细探讨如何利用DeepSeek工具进行量化交易策略的组合优化,从数据预处理、特征工程到模型构建与优化,提供一套完整的解决方案,旨在提升策略收益与稳定性。
一、量化交易策略组合优化的核心挑战
量化交易的核心在于通过数学模型捕捉市场规律,但传统方法面临两大瓶颈:一是策略同质化导致收益衰减,二是市场环境变化引发策略失效。组合优化通过动态调整策略权重,可实现风险分散与收益增强,但需解决高维参数空间搜索、非线性关系建模等复杂问题。DeepSeek凭借其强大的机器学习框架与优化算法,为解决这些挑战提供了新范式。
二、DeepSeek技术栈与量化场景的适配性
DeepSeek的核心优势在于其灵活的算法库与高效的并行计算能力。针对量化优化场景,其技术栈包含三大模块:
- 特征工程模块:支持时间序列分解、波动率建模、市场状态识别等量化专用特征提取方法。
- 优化算法库:集成遗传算法、粒子群优化、贝叶斯优化等非凸优化算法,适应策略组合的高维搜索空间。
- 回测仿真引擎:内置并行化回测框架,支持分钟级数据回测与多市场场景模拟。
典型应用场景包括:跨资产策略配置、多因子模型权重优化、高频交易信号时序对齐等。
三、组合优化实施路径:四步走框架
1. 数据准备与特征构建
原始市场数据需经过三重处理:
- 清洗层:处理缺失值、异常值,统一数据频率
- 特征层:构建滚动统计量(如20日波动率)、市场状态指示器(如VIX指数分区)
- 标签层:定义多维度收益目标(如夏普比率、最大回撤、胜率)
示例代码(Python伪代码):
import deepseek as ds# 加载多品种分钟级数据data = ds.load_data(['SPY', 'GLD', 'BTC'], freq='1min')# 构建特征矩阵features = ds.FeatureEngineering(rolling_stats={'volatility': {'window': 20, 'method': 'std'}},state_indicators={'market_regime': {'VIX': {'thresholds': [15, 25]}}})
2. 策略池构建与初筛
建立包含趋势跟踪、均值回归、统计套利等类型的策略库,通过以下指标进行初筛:
- 年化收益率 > 15%
- 夏普比率 > 0.8
- 最大回撤 < 25%
- 胜率 > 55%
DeepSeek的StrategyEvaluator模块可自动化完成该流程:
strategy_pool = ds.StrategyLibrary([ds.TrendFollowing(params={'fast_ma': 5, 'slow_ma': 20}),ds.MeanReversion(params={'lookback': 60, 'zscore_threshold': 2})])selected_strategies = strategy_pool.filter(metrics={'annual_return': (15, None), 'sharpe': (0.8, None)})
3. 组合优化算法设计
采用两阶段优化框架:
第一阶段:策略相关性降维
运用主成分分析(PCA)或独立成分分析(ICA)消除策略间的共线性:
from sklearn.decomposition import PCAcorr_matrix = selected_strategies.calculate_correlation()pca = PCA(n_components=0.95) # 保留95%方差reduced_strategies = pca.fit_transform(corr_matrix)
第二阶段:权重优化
应用带约束的粒子群优化算法(PSO),目标函数设计为:
maximize: α * SharpeRatio - β * MaxDrawdown + γ * ConsistencyScoresubject to: ∑w_i = 1, 0 ≤ w_i ≤ 0.3
其中α,β,γ为风险偏好系数,可通过DeepSeek的贝叶斯优化自动调参:
optimizer = ds.PSOOptimizer(objective=lambda w: evaluate_portfolio(w, metrics=['sharpe', 'drawdown']),constraints={'sum': 1, 'bounds': (0, 0.3)},hyperparams={'swarm_size': 50, 'iterations': 100})optimal_weights = optimizer.run()
4. 动态再平衡机制
建立市场状态监测模型,当检测到以下信号时触发再平衡:
- 波动率突变(超过历史均值2个标准差)
- 策略相关性结构变化(PCA主成分贡献率变动>15%)
- 宏观经济指标突破阈值(如失业率、CPI)
再平衡频率建议设置为季度调整+事件驱动的混合模式,避免过度优化。
四、收益与稳定性提升的实证效果
在2020-2023年的测试中,优化后的组合展现显著优势:
| 指标 | 优化前 | 优化后 | 提升幅度 |
|———————|————|————|—————|
| 年化收益率 | 18.2% | 24.7% | +35.7% |
| 夏普比率 | 0.92 | 1.38 | +47.8% |
| 最大回撤 | 22.4% | 15.6% | -30.4% |
| 收益稳定性 | 0.65 | 0.82 | +26.2% |
关键改进点包括:
- 风险分散:通过相关性约束将组合有效前沿向右上方移动
- 参数鲁棒性:优化后的策略对交易成本敏感度降低40%
- 适应能力:在2022年市场剧烈波动期间,优化组合回撤比基准低12个百分点
五、实施建议与风险控制
1. 渐进式优化策略
建议采用”核心+卫星”模式:
- 核心策略(60%权重):长期稳定的趋势跟踪系统
- 卫星策略(40%权重):动态优化的高频/统计套利策略
2. 过拟合防范措施
- 数据分区:训练集(60%)、验证集(20%)、测试集(20%)
- 正则化约束:在优化目标中加入L2范数惩罚项
- 现实性检验:要求优化结果在样本外持续6个月以上
3. 技术实施要点
- 硬件配置:建议使用GPU加速的DeepSeek实例,处理百万级参数优化
- 实时性保障:优化过程应在市场开盘前1小时完成
- 异常处理:建立优化失败时的默认权重分配机制
六、未来演进方向
随着深度学习与强化学习的融合,下一代优化框架可探索:
- 深度组合优化:用神经网络直接学习最优权重分配
- 在线学习机制:实时吸收新数据调整策略配置
- 多目标优化:同时优化收益、风险、流动性等多维度目标
结语:DeepSeek为量化交易策略组合优化提供了强大的技术工具,但成功的关键在于将算法优势与金融逻辑深度结合。通过系统化的优化框架与严格的风险控制,投资者可显著提升策略的收益风险比,在复杂多变的市场环境中保持竞争优势。

发表评论
登录后可评论,请前往 登录 或 注册